Nrg-Bn001- Randomized Phase II Trial Of Hypofractionated Dose-Escalated Photon Imrt Or Proton Beam Therapy Versus Conventional Photon Irradiation With Concomitant And Adjuvant Temozolomide In Patients With Newly Diagnosed Glioblastoma

The purpose of this study is to compare a different radiation therapy schedule and higher radiation dose to the standard dose of radiation therapy. All patients will receive usual chemotherapy, temozolomide.
Criteria:
To Be Eligible For This Study, Must Have A Diagnosed Glioblastoma Tumor, Age 18 Or Older, Nonpregnant/Nonbreastfeeding, No Prior Invasive Malignancy For 3 Years Minimum, No Severe, Active Comorbidities.
